Wednesday, April 6, 2016

Dog whose stomach was split open makes incredible recovery

These guys at Animal Aid Unlimited, India always deal with the worst-case animal rescues and never ceases to do an amazing job on their recovery...

This awfully injured street dog gave our rescue team the biggest welcome ever.

